Benefits Specialist at Excel Academy Charter School
Job Summary
Job Summary
The position manages employee benefit programs such as medical, dental, vision, life, and disability insurance through Paycom. Key duties include supporting enrollment for new hires, life events, and open enrollment; preparing benefits communication materials; reconciling payroll and carrier billing; completing ACA reporting; maintaining accurate HRIS records; handling COBRA administration; resolving employee benefit issues; and coordinating with brokers, vendors, and carriers to ensure smooth plan administration and service delivery. The role also oversees leave management, serving as the main contact for employees, managers, and HR on leave requests such as FMLA, CFRA, disability, pregnancy-related leave, workers’ compensation, and military leave. Responsibilities include determining eligibility, issuing required notices and forms, supporting accommodations and the interactive process under ADA/FEHA, coordinating with payroll on pay and benefits during leave, managing premium billing for unpaid leave, and handling return-to-work clearances and reintegration. Overall, the role ensures compliance, accuracy, and employee support across benefits and leave processes.
